Seven Pines is a small place in Marion County, West Virginia, in the United States. It is known as an unincorporated community, which means it doesn't have its own local government like a city or town. The post office in Seven Pines is now closed.

What is an Unincorporated Community?

An unincorporated community is a place where people live together, but it is not officially organized as a city or town. This means it doesn't have its own local government. Instead, it is governed by the larger county or state. For example, the police, fire department, and other services are usually provided by the county.

Many small communities across the United States are unincorporated. They often have a unique history and a strong sense of community among their residents.

Where is Seven Pines Located?

Seven Pines is found in West Virginia, a state known for its mountains and forests. It is specifically located in Marion County. This county is in the north-central part of West Virginia. The community is situated at an elevation of about 1,063 feet (324 meters) above sea level. Its coordinates are 39°34′00″N 80°26′30″W.
